AI Technical Summary

Technical Problem

Existing reconciliation auxiliary frames are inconvenient to use in dark or poorly lit environments, and the angle of use cannot be freely adjusted, resulting in poor adaptability and easy occurrence of reconciliation errors.

Method used

The system employs a combination of support, limiting, and scale mechanisms. Through the cooperation of components such as pillars, shafts, connecting rods, turntables, locking holes, fixing plates, pull plates, top plates, locking heads, and arc-shaped spring sheets, the system achieves angle adjustment and fixation of the ledger. The limiting mechanism uses screws, linkage plates, and limiting pressure plates to fix the ledger. The scale mechanism uses sliders, sliding rods, handles, and scales to perform line-by-line reconciliation.

Benefits of technology

The adaptability of the reconciliation auxiliary frame has been improved, ensuring ease of use under different lighting conditions, avoiding cross-checking during reconciliation, and improving the accuracy and efficiency of reconciliation.

Description

Technical Field

[0001] This utility model relates to the field of accounting technology, specifically to a reconciliation auxiliary frame. Background Technology

[0002] Accounting has two meanings: one refers to accounting work, and the other refers to accounting staff. Accounting work is the process of verifying accounting vouchers, financial books, and financial statements in accordance with the Accounting Law, Budget Law, Statistics Law, and various tax regulations, and engaging in economic accounting and supervision. It is an economic management work that uses currency as the main unit of measurement and employs specialized methods to account for and supervise the economic activities of an entity. Accounting staff are the personnel who perform accounting work, including accounting supervisors, accounting supervisors and accountants, property managers, cashiers, etc. Accountants need to use reconciliation aids when reconciling accounts.

[0003] Patent publication number CN204414865U discloses an accounting reconciliation auxiliary frame, including a base plate and a partition plate. The base plate is rectangular, and a partition plate is provided in the middle of its surface. A positioning clip is provided on the lower side of the base plate. A sliding groove is provided on the side of the base plate, and a slider is provided in the sliding groove. The upper part of the slider is higher than the surface of the base plate and is fixedly connected to a marking ruler.

[0004] To address the problem of difficulty in reading text and easy mismatches in dimly lit rooms or in dark weather, existing technology involves adding lighting equipment to make reading accounts easier in dimly lit places. Marking rulers can prevent mismatches during reconciliation. However, the angle of the reconciliation frame cannot be freely adjusted according to the user's needs, resulting in poor adaptability of the device. Utility Model Content

[0005] The purpose of this utility model is to provide an accounting assistance frame to solve the problems mentioned in the background art.

[0006] To solve the above-mentioned technical problems, the technical solution adopted by this utility model is as follows:

[0007] A reconciliation auxiliary frame includes a base, a support mechanism on the top surface of the base, a reconciliation plate on the top of the support mechanism, limit mechanisms on both sides of the top surface of the reconciliation plate, and a scale mechanism on the right side of the reconciliation plate.

[0008] The support mechanism includes a pillar fixedly connected to the top surface of the base. The top of the pillar has a groove, and a rotating shaft is rotatably connected to the side of the groove. A connecting rod is fixedly sleeved on the surface of the rotating shaft. One end of the connecting rod is fixedly connected to the back of the accounting board. One end of the rotating shaft extends to the outside of the pillar and is fixedly connected to a turntable. The surface of the turntable has a locking hole.

[0009] A further improvement of the present invention is that: a fixing plate is fixedly connected to the side of the support column, a pull plate is movably sleeved in the middle of the fixing plate, a top plate is fixedly connected to the top of the pull plate, a clip is fixedly connected to the top surface of the top plate, the clip holes are evenly distributed on the surface of the turntable, and one end of the clip is engaged with the clip hole.

[0010] A further improvement of this utility model is that: the bottom end of the pull plate extends to the bottom of the fixed plate, and arc-shaped spring pieces are fixedly connected to both sides of the bottom surface of the top plate, with the bottom ends of the arc-shaped spring pieces fixedly connected to the top surface of the fixed plate.

[0011] A further improvement of the present invention is that the limiting mechanism includes a limiting seat fixedly connected to the surface of the accounting board, a plate groove is provided in the middle of the limiting seat, a linkage plate is slidably connected inside the plate groove, and a limiting pressure plate is fixedly connected to one end of the linkage plate.

[0012] A further improvement of this utility model is that: a screw is rotatably connected to the top surface of the other end of the linkage plate, a support plate is fixedly connected to the top surface of the limiting seat, the top end of the screw penetrates the support plate and extends to the top of the support plate, and the screw is threadedly connected to the support plate.

[0013] A further improvement of this utility model is that the scale mechanism includes a positioning plate fixedly connected to the right side of the accounting board, and there are two positioning plates. A sliding rod is fixedly connected between the two positioning plates, and a slider is slidably connected to the surface of the sliding rod.

[0014] A further improvement of this utility model is that: a handle is fixedly connected to the right side of the slider, and a ruler is fixedly connected to the left side of the slider, with the ruler being parallel to the accounting board.

[0015] Due to the adoption of the above technical solution, the technological progress achieved by this utility model compared to the prior art is as follows:

[0016] 1. This utility model provides an accounting auxiliary frame, which adopts the cooperation of a support mechanism, a pillar, a rotating shaft, a connecting rod, a turntable, a locking hole, a fixing plate, a pull plate, a top plate, a locking head, an arc-shaped spring piece, and an accounting plate. By pulling the pull plate downward, the top plate moves downward, and the top plate moves the locking head downward and separates it from the locking hole. At the same time, the top plate squeezes the arc-shaped spring piece to generate elastic force. At this time, the accounting plate is rotated to adjust the angle. The accounting plate moves the connecting rod, the connecting rod drives the rotating shaft to rotate, and the rotating shaft drives the turntable to rotate. After rotating to the appropriate angle, the pull plate is released, and the arc-shaped spring piece restores its elastic force, causing the locking head to lock into the locking hole at the current position for fixation. This realizes the adjustment of the angle of the accounting plate and improves its adaptability.

[0017] 2. This utility model provides a reconciliation auxiliary frame, which adopts the cooperation of a limiting mechanism, a limiting seat, a linkage plate, a screw, a support plate, a limiting pressure plate, and a reconciliation plate. By placing the ledger on the surface of the reconciliation plate and rotating the screw, the screw and the support plate interact with each other, causing the screw to drive the linkage plate to move down. The linkage plate then drives the limiting pressure plate to move down, so that the limiting pressure plate presses against the top of the ledger for fixation, thereby limiting the ledger and facilitating the subsequent reconciliation process.

[0018] 3. This utility model provides a reconciliation auxiliary frame, which adopts the cooperation of a ruler mechanism, a positioning plate, a sliding rod, a slider, a handle, and a ruler. By holding the handle, the slider is moved. When the slider moves on the surface of the sliding rod, it drives the ruler to move. The movement of the ruler can reconcile the ledger line by line, avoiding the problem of reconciliation errors and improving the accuracy of reconciliation. Attached Figure Description

[0032] The working principle of this reconciliation auxiliary frame will be explained in detail below.

[0033] like Figure 1-5 As shown, during use, according to the user's desired angle, pulling down the pull plate 27 causes the top plate 28 to move down. The top plate 28 causes the locking head 29 to move down and separate from the locking hole 25. At the same time, the top plate 28 presses the arc-shaped spring piece 210 to generate elasticity. At this time, rotating the alignment plate 3 adjusts the angle. The alignment plate 3 causes the connecting rod 23 to move, the connecting rod 23 causes the rotating shaft 22 to rotate, and the rotating shaft 22 causes the turntable 24 to rotate. After rotating to the appropriate angle, releasing the pull plate 27 causes the arc-shaped spring piece 210 to regain its elasticity, causing the locking head 29 to engage. The ledger is fixed in the current position within the card hole 25. Then, the ledger is placed on the surface of the reconciliation plate 3. The screw 43 is rotated, and the screw 43 and the support plate 44 are threaded together, causing the screw 43 to drive the linkage plate 42 to move down. The linkage plate 42 drives the limiting pressure plate 45 to move down, so that the limiting pressure plate 45 presses against the top of the ledger for fixation. Finally, the user holds the handle 54 to drive the slider 53 to move. When the slider 53 moves on the surface of the slider 52, it drives the ruler 55 to move. The movement of the ruler 55 can reconcile the ledger line by line.
